sábado, 7 de diciembre de 2013

Ordenador de buceo III

Aunque lentamente, este proyecto avanza. Al fin he terminado el diseño de los circuitos y la placa base del ordenador. Esta incluye las conexiones entre el microcontrolador y los periféricos como la pantalla, reloj de tiempo real, sensor de presión, etc.
También he podido incluir en esta placa el control de encendido y un sensor de agua, lo que permitirá que el ordenador se encienda automáticamente cuando entre en contacto con el agua. Inicialmente tenía pensado hacer esto en una placa aparte como un módulo. Pero incluirlo todo en la misma disminuirá el tamaño del ordenador a costa de una mayor complicación de diseño de la placa.
Aún quedan algunas decisiones que no son definitivas como, por ejemplo, utilizar una batería de LiPo para la alimentación. Quizás más adelante busque una solución más eficiente. Sobre todo con mayor autonomía. Pero, para una primera versión, usar esta fuente de alimentación simplifica el diseño ya que hay una amplia gama de circuitos que proporcionan 5V a partir de una de estas baterías.
A continuación muestro una imagen tridimensional de la placa base. Ahora a ir preparando la insoladora...

miércoles, 25 de septiembre de 2013

DIR

Hace tiempo que quería traducir este texto que encontré navegando en busca de información sobre buceo técnico. Originalmente fue publicado de forma anónima en un foro de buceo técnico. Yo lo encontré en esta web http://njscuba.net/gear/trng_08_dir.html

Creo que es una buena visión de hasta que punto los buzos nos dejamos llevar por nuestra afición al buceo y a los tecnicismos. Espero que disfrutéis como yo leyéndolo. Y ya sabéis, si os gusta y queréis seguir leyendo cosas así, suscribiros a mi blog.

---------------------------------------------------

Sobre DIR y otros temas religiosos ( una broma )


Advertencia: Políticamente incorrecto

Me convertí al DIR ( "Doing It Right ") hace unos 6 meses y me he dado cuenta que la filosofía se extiende mucho más allá de buceo. Creo que la mayoría de la gente tiende a ver a DIR como una configuración del equipo o tipo de buceo, pero realmente es una filosofía que se puede utilizar en otras partes de su vida. Por ejemplo, a continuación podemos ver algunas de las maneras en que he aplicado la filosofía DIR en otras áreas de mi vida.

La semana pasada, algunos de mis amigos vinieron a mi casa . Aunque no todos ellos son buceadores entienden la filosofía DIR . Así, en primer lugar, todos bebemos el mismo tipo de cerveza. Esto evita las situaciones en las que podría estar disfrutando de una lager y, sin querer coger una ale (o al revés). Eso podría ser muy desagradable. Podría conducir rápidamente a una situación de pánico, por lo que lo evitamos de forma conjunta. También bebemos sólo de latas y no botellas. Y nunca tenemos la cerveza en la nevera. Siempre la tenemos en un cubo con hielo en mi sala de estar. El 47 % de incidentes relacionados con el consumo de alcohol ( DRI ) se producen cuando alguien va a la nevera a por otra cerveza, por lo que es mejor prevenir que curar. Por supuesto, todo esto se ensaya  mientras seguimos siendo 100 % sobrio para que no haya alteraciones en el juicio una vez que las cosas se ponen en marcha.

Todos nosotros usamos un collar Bungie con una cerveza completa sobre el mismo por si alguien experimenta un "quedarse sin cerveza" ( OOB ) de emergencia. Puedo ofrecer mi cerveza abierta hacia mi amigo y simplemente agacharme y agarrar la copia de seguridad de mi collar de cerveza. Y, sin excepción, siempre utilizamos la manguera de 7 pies en el grifo de cerveza .

Por supuesto, no nos quedamos en casa todas las noches, así que, cuando decidimos salir, nos aseguramos de que estamos siendo DIR . Todos nosotros usamos exactamente la misma ropa :


  • 501 Jeans Levi , negro ( cierre con botones , pierna recta )
  • Camiseta negra
  • Calzoncillos boxer negros
  • Calcetines negros
  • Zapatos Kenneth Cole, estilo de Brad Bitt, negro
  • Reloj G-Shock , banda negro
  • Correa de nylon negra, con hebilla militar
  • Chaqueta de cuero negro (opcional, dependiendo de las condiciones climáticas)


Esto puede sonar un poco tonto o exagerado, pero créanme, cuando se está penetrando un club de noche, sabiendo exactamente que sus amigos se visten igual, puede marcar una diferencia importante, si usted tiene la esperanza de enganchar algún bombón. Digamos que veo alguna chica y justo antes de que me levanto para ir a hablar con ella una camarera derrama una bebida en mi regazo. No hay problema, porque siempre puedo cambiar los pantalones con mi amigo. Yo no tengo que preocuparme si coinciden, porque sé que él está usando 501 de Levi. Bam! Intercambia los pantalones y todavía puedo completar mi objetivo.

Una cosa a tener en cuenta acerca de las discotecas es que rara vez se quiere beber cerveza . Lo sé, algunos de los idiotas machistas hacen esto y presumen con sus amigos. Créeme, no es DIR. Tienes que beber bebidas mezcladas. Obviamente, la mezcla será diferente en diferentes noches, pero una buena mezcla de vodka con tónica es bastante estándar. Una vez más, hay una manera correcta y una manera incorrecta de hacer esto. No se puede pedir cualquier vodka de cualquier edad o depender de algún camarero para conseguir la mezcla correcta. Eso es lo que hacen los aficionados. No, tu pides Stoli vodka que tiene una excelente reputación en la comunidad de fiestas DIR. La mezcla correcta es 2 partes de Stoli con agua tónica vertida sobre hielo en un vaso alto (limón o lima opcional). Siempre llevo un kit de prueba conmigo y si la mezcla está floja la devuelvo. No vale la pena el riesgo y no es DIR.

Así que entras en la discoteca y tienes una buena mezcla, ahora es el momento de cumplir con las damas. Debería haber dicho esto antes pero vigilen su consumo de bebidas. Es un hecho bien conocido que las mujeres exigen un 25% - 30% más en un club nocturno, y si te quedas narcotizado con el vodka con tónica, aumenta las probabilidades de parecer un coyote ambriento. Usted debe que mantener despierto su ingenio.

Si es temprano, es probable que tenga buena visibilidad. Más tarde en la noche, cuando las nubes de humo llenen la habitación, va a ser difícil distinguir a las mujeres en el otro lado del club para establecer un rumbo a tiempo. En algunas ocasiones he tenido que lanzar un hilo guía sólo para ir al baño y de regresar.

Si tienes la suerte de conectar con un buen bombón es cuando hacer las cosas realmente de forma correcta puede proporcionar un benerifio. Ahora, seamos sinceros, hay un cierto grado de peligro involucrado aquí que no quiero minimizar. Es necesario reducir al mínimo sus riesgos mediante el uso de los equipos adecuados. Llevo 2 condones. Uno puse en mi... bueno ya sabes, y el segundo me lo puse en un bolsillo atado alrededor de mi cintura. Si hay un fallo en mi primaria, puedo ir rápidamente a la copia de seguridad sin perder el ritmo.

Así, como se puede ver en estos ejemplos muy básicos, DIR no es sólo para el buceo. Es algo que se puede utilizar en todas las áreas de su vida .

Deben ser realistas.

domingo, 1 de septiembre de 2013

Ordenador de buceo II

Después de un "accidentado" verano, vuelvo a retomar el tema del ordenador de buceo.

Tras varias búsquedas por internet se van perfilando algunos de los módulos hardware que necesitaré. El siguiente esquema muestra los mejores candidatos:


El sensor de profundidad MS5541 es capaz de medir hasta una profundidad de 130 metros. Hubiese preferido un rango mayor, pero no encuentro ningún sensor en el mercado capaz de medir una presión mayor de 14 bares. Al menos que se pueda comprar al por menor. De hecho, este chip es bastante difícil de localizar. Sólo he encontrado dos puntos de venta en internet.

Otro de los inconvenientes que presenta el sensor de presión es que requiere una señal de 32KHz externa para realizar la medida. Sin embargo esto lo he resuelto fácilmente utilizando como reloj de tiempo real el módulo basado en el chip DS3231 que, además de ser más preciso que otros módulos basados en otros chips de esta familia, genera justo la señal de reloj que requiere el sensor de presión. Cualquiera diría que han sido diseñados para trabajar juntos.

Los relés reed para los botones me parecen una buena opción ya que permiten controlar el ordenador sin necesidad de hacer perforaciones en la caja estanca. Con esto espero simplificar su diseño y disminuir la probabilidad de que se inunde.

Aún me quedan dos frentes abiertos:
1. ¿Convendría poner un sensor de humedad? Esto permitiría que el ordenador de encendiese solo al entrar en contacto con el agua. Aunque complica el diseño de la fuente de alimentación. e implica más agujeros en la caja estana.
2. ¿Que alimentación utilizar para el circuito? No estoy seguro si debería utilizar pilas recargables, baterias de LiPo, etc. Los principales factores a tener en cuenta son: tamaño, peso y autonomía. Sin olvidar que, en caso de utilizar baterias recargables, habrá que añadir un módulo de carga y conectores.

Y hasta aquí he llegado. Si alguien tiene alguna idea sobre como solucionar las cuestiones que quedan abiertas que no dude en escribirlo en los comentarios de este blog.

Continuará...


martes, 23 de julio de 2013

Ordenador de buceo I

Hola de nuevo! Aprovechando que se acercan las vacaciones y tengo un poco más de "tiempo libre" voy a empezar un proyecto que hace tiempo tenía en mente: construir un ordenador de buceo.

La idea básicamente consiste en utilizar componentes fácilmente localizables en tiendas de electrónica o internet, entre ellos un microcontrolador económico, para fabricar un ordenador de buceo completamente funcional y a un precio competitivo con los existentes comercialmente.

Un ordenador de buceo deportivo corriente puede costar unos 200€, esto da muy poco margen para el desarrollo casero. Además sería difícil justificar el mayor tamaño o consumo de energía que tendría el ordenador que podría construir. Para ser competitivo hay que apuntar más alto, a un tipo de ordenador donde la relación precio/funcionalidad sea mucho mayor. Esto se corresponde a los ordenadores de buceo técnico que permiten combinarr varias mezclas de aire e incluso trimix en una misma inmersión. En este caso, el precio de un ordenador de estas características supera ampliamente el coste de los materiales. Esto deja margen para que podamos desarrollar de forma más económica un ordenador de estas características.

Las funciones que debería implementar un ordenador de estas características son:
  • Controlar la saturación de los tejidos. Así como los tiempos a no descompresión y las paradas de descompresión
  • Controlar la profundidad y tiempo de inmersión.
  • Almacenar un registro de la inmersión.
  • Permitir almacenar varias mezclas de gases que incluyan opcionalmente helio y permitir cambiar entre ellas durante la inmersión. Los ordenadores técnicos comerciales suelen permitir unas 15 mezclas diferentes en la misma inmersión.
  • Premitir ajustar parámetros de seguridad de la inmersión como por ejemplo los factores gradientes del algoritmos Bülhmann.
El microcontrolador que quiero utilizar es un Arduino. Un microcontrolador económico, fácil de encontrar y con una amplia documentación. Esta es una foto de uno de los modelos más pequeños: un arduino nano:


Y esta la foto del hermano mayor de la familia: un arduino duo con una capacidad unas 95 veces superior a la del modelo anterior.


La cuestión es cual de los dos utilizar o incluso si utilizar alguno de los otros modelos disponibles. Claro que esto es una pregunta que habrá que responder más adelante tras estimar el tamaño del software necesario y los datos que procesará.

La primera cuestión de diseño que habrá que plantearse es que módulos hardware son necesarios para implementar las funcionalidades indicadas más arriba y que componentes concretos existen en el mercado que los proporcionen. Pero eso es una cuestión que resolveré en la siguiente entrada a este blog.

Continuará...